QuickBooks Desktop 2023 Phase Out

QuickBooks Desktop 2023 phase out follows a consistent lifecycle policy set by Intuit. Each Desktop version is supported for about three years, after which critical services are discontinued.
This often raises the question, is QuickBooks Desktop being phased out, but the answer is more nuanced. The software itself doesn’t disappear, yet the tools that make it functional for modern business needs begin to shut down.
What the phrase “phase out” actually involves is:

  • End of essential services

Features like payroll processing, payment services, and live bank feeds are discontinued. Without these, the daily accounting workflows become manual and time consuming.

  • No security updates or patches

Once support ends, vulnerabilities are no longer fixed. This increases exposure to data risks, especially for businesses handling sensitive financial records.

  • No technical support from Intuit

Troubleshooting help, updates, and compatibility fixes are no longer available, which can slow down issue resolution significantly.

For users wondering about regional impact, including QuickBooks Desktop being phased out in the U.S., the policy applies across all supported regions. Intuit follows the same discontinuation structure globally, meaning U.S. users experience the same service shutdown timeline.

It’s also important to understand that QuickBooks Desktop being phased out does not mean your software will stop opening. You can still access historical data and run basic reports.
However, without integrations and updates, the system becomes increasingly outdated and less reliable for active financial management.

When Will QuickBooks Desktop 2023 Be Phased Out?

The question that is running riot nowadays is not about will QuickBooks Desktop 2023 be phased out, but more about when exactly will it happen. Based on Intuit’s standard lifecycle policy, QuickBooks Desktop versions are discontinued roughly three years after release. For the 2023 edition, the expected service discontinuation will take place around May 31, 2026.

And, once QuickBooks Desktop 2023 phased out status takes effect, several connected services will stop functioning. It’s not a surprise shutdown, but a gradual loss of capabilities that can impact daily operations.

  • Features like tax table updates, direct deposit features, and payroll compliance tools won’t function any longer, making payroll processing not so reliable.
  • Automatic transaction downloads from banks and credit cards will stop, which then will be requiring manual entry and reconciliation.
  • Features like QuickBooks Payments won’t work, in turn affecting the invoicing and customer payment workflows.
  • Apps relying on updated APIs may stop syncing properly, creating workflow gaps.

And so the answer to the question “is QuickBooks Desktop 2023 being phased out in the U.S.”, still remains the same. The discontinuation timeline applies equally in the United States.

Another important point in the broader QuickBooks Desktop phase out process is that your data remains accessible. You can still open company files, run reports, and view historical records.

What Happens To QuickBooks Pro, Premier, And Enterprise 2023 Versions After 31 May 2026?

When discussing discontinuation, many users want clarity on specific editions, especially is QuickBooks Desktop enterprise being phased out and how it compares to other versions. The answer depends on the product type, as each follows a slightly different model under Intuit’s ecosystem.

1. QuickBooks Desktop Pro and Premier
These are traditionally one time purchase licenses. After discontinuation:

  • Connected services like payroll and banking stop working.
  • No further updates or patches are released.
  • The software continues in a limited, offline capacity.

This is why questions like “is QuickBooks Desktop pro being phased out?” come up frequently.
Also, new Sales for QuickBooks Desktop Pro and Premier version have already been discontinued. Existing subscribers can still renew their versions, but support for the 2023 edition will also end.

2. QuickBooks Desktop Enterprise

Enterprise operates on a subscription based model. This leads to confusion around QuickBooks Desktop Enterprise 2023 being phased out. The key difference is:

  • The 2023 version follows the same discontinuation rules.
  • However, active subscribers can upgrade to newer releases without losing access.
  • Continued support depends on maintaining the subscription.

This also answers broader concerns such as “is QuickBooks Desktop Enterprise being phased out?”. The product itself is not being eliminated, but older versions are retired as newer ones replace them.

Although, it is important to remember that regardless of the edition or version:

  • There will be no compliance updates for tax or regulations.
  • The compatibility risk issues with newer operating systems will be increased.
  • The efficiency will be reduced due to lack of automation tools.

How To Upgrade QuickBooks Desktop 2023 To QuickBooks Desktop 2024?

Updating to the most recent version is the simplest method of staying in good shape. If you’re still wondering if QuickBooks Desktop will be phased out, updating is essential to ensure that you are running a fully functional program.

Follow these steps carefully to complete the upgrade:

  • Always do data backups with the built-in backup tool ,before making any updates. It will help you save your records in case of any problems arising after an update.
  • Make sure your system meets the 2024 requirements. This prevents installation errors and ensures stable performance after upgrading.
  • Purchase or download QuickBooks Desktop 2024. You can either download it directly from your Intuit account or through the official QuickBooks website but only if you’ve purchased the license.
  • Install the new version, run the installer and follow on-screen instructions. Choose the appropriate setup (Express or Custom) based on your needs.
  • Open and upgrade your company file and when you first open your existing file in the 2024 version, QuickBooks will ask you to upgrade it. Do it as this step updates the file structure to match it with the new version.
  • After upgrading, run basic reports and check balances to ensure everything has transferred correctly.

Migration Guide On How To Move QuickBooks Desktop 2023 To QuickBooks Online

For many businesses, moving to the cloud is a practical alternative as older desktop versions reach end of life.
If you’re evaluating options due to the query of “is QuickBooks Desktop 2023 being phased out?” spreading out quickly, know that QuickBooks Online offers flexibility, remote access, and automatic updates.
Follow the steps given below to migrate your data properly:

  • Clean up your data before you begin with migration. Reconcile accounts, remove duplicate entries, and ensure everything is up to date.
  • Sign in to QuickBooks Online and set up your account and choose the appropriate subscription plan based on your business size and needs.
  • Utilize the in-built migration tool. Access your Desktop file; click on the Company tab and then select to export data to QuickBooks Online. You will be guided through the procedure.
  • This tool migrates your lists, balances, and transactions from one file to another. Time taken to migrate data will vary depending on the size of the file.
  • After migration, compare financial reports such as Profit and Loss and Balance Sheet to ensure accuracy.
  • Set up integrations and preferences. Reconnect bank feeds, payroll, and third party apps within the Online platform.

QuickBooks Desktop vs QuickBooks Online – Which One Should You Choose?

Choosing between QuickBooks Desktop and Online becomes more important as QuickBooks Desktop being phased out versions lose functionality over time.
Both options are strong, but they serve different business needs depending on how you operate and scale.

Feature QuickBooks Desktop QuickBooks Online
Accessibility Installed on one system (or hosted) Cloud-based, access from anywhere
Updates Manual, version-based Automatic, always up to date
Cost Model One-time (Pro/Premier) or subscription (Enterprise) Monthly subscription
Features Advanced reporting, industry-specific tools Strong integrations, real-time sync
Collaboration Limited without hosting Easy multi-user collaboration

A few practical considerations before you make a decision:

1. Choose QuickBooks Desktop if you prefer having advanced features
If your business is relying more on detailed reporting, job costing, or industry specific tools, you must go for QuickBooks Desktop, especially the Enterprise version.

2. Choose QuickBooks Online for flexibility and remote access

If your team focuses more on working remotely and needs real time collaboration, QuickBooks Online offers a better solution.

3. Consider long term sustainability

As older versions lose support, having complete dependency on QuickBooks Desktop without upgrading can create limitations over time.
